In today’s fast-paced digital landscape, providing stellar customer support can be the differentiating factor for businesses aiming to thrive. Live chat software has emerged as a critical tool for delivering immediate, efficient, and personalized customer service.
While numerous options are available, open-source solutions stand out due to their flexibility, cost-effectiveness, and active community support. This article will guide you through the nine best open-source live chat software options for 2025, highlighting their key features and unique aspects to help you make an informed decision for your business.
Why Use Open Source Live Chat Software for Your Business?
1. Cost-Effectiveness: Open-source software is generally free to use, making it an attractive option for businesses of all sizes, especially startups and small to medium-sized enterprises (SMEs).
2. Customization: Open-source software can be tailored to meet the specific needs of your business, offering unparalleled flexibility and adaptability.
3. Security: With access to the source code, businesses can identify and fix vulnerabilities, ensuring higher levels of security.
4. Community Support: A robust community of developers and users provides ongoing support, updates, and enhancements, ensuring the software remains relevant and up-to-date.
5. Transparency: Open source projects are developed transparently, allowing users to see the development process, contribute to it, and trust in the software’s integrity.
The Best Open-Source Live Chat Software in 2025
1. Chatstack
Chatstack, formerly known as Live Help Messenger, is a robust live chat solution designed to integrate seamlessly with your website, enabling real-time customer support. With its intuitive interface and rich feature set, Chatstack helps businesses engage with customers more effectively, providing instant assistance and improving overall customer satisfaction.

Key Features:
- Real-Time Monitoring: Monitor visitors in real-time and initiate proactive chats to engage them at critical moments.
- Customizable Chat Widgets: Tailor chat widgets to match your website’s branding and provide a consistent user experience.
- Offline Messaging: Allow customers to leave messages when agents are unavailable, ensuring no query goes unanswered.
- File Sharing: Share files and images easily during chat sessions to enhance communication and support.
- Mobile App Support: Provide support on the go with mobile app integrations, ensuring you can assist customers anytime, anywhere.
Fun Fact:
Chatstack was one of the first live chat solutions on the market, launched in 2003, making it one of the oldest and most experienced platforms available today.
2. Chatwoot
Chatwoot is an open-source customer engagement suite that offers live chat, social media integration, and email support in a single platform. It aims to provide a seamless customer service experience by consolidating all communication channels into one easy-to-use interface, helping businesses manage their customer interactions more effectively.

Key Features:
- Omni-Channel Support: Manage interactions from live chat, social media, email, and more in one centralized platform.
- Intuitive Dashboard: A user-friendly interface simplifies managing conversations, making it easy for agents to provide prompt support.
- Customizable Widgets: Adjust chat widgets to align with your brand’s look and feel, enhancing your website’s user experience.
- Automation: Automate repetitive tasks with workflows and canned responses, improving efficiency and response times.
- Analytics and Reporting: Gain insights with detailed analytics and reports, helping you understand customer behavior and improve service quality.
Fun Fact:
Chatwoot began as a side project in 2017 and quickly gained popularity, thanks to its active open-source community and robust feature set.
3. Papercups
Papercups is a modern, developer-friendly live chat software designed to integrate seamlessly with existing tools and workflows. Its focus on developer experience and flexibility makes it an excellent choice for businesses looking to customize and extend their customer support capabilities.

Key Features:
- Slack Integration: Handle live chat conversations directly from Slack, streamlining communication and team collaboration.
- Customizable Widgets: Personalize chat widgets to suit your website’s design, creating a cohesive brand experience.
- Open API: Extend functionality and integrate with other systems using the open API, enabling you to build custom solutions.
- Multi-Language Support: Offer support in multiple languages to cater to a global audience, enhancing customer satisfaction.
- Analytics Dashboard: Track performance with real-time analytics and metrics, providing insights into customer interactions and agent performance.
Fun Fact:
Papercups was created by a team of ex-Airbnb engineers who aimed to bring a modern, developer-centric approach to live chat software.
4. Live Helper Chat
Live Helper Chat is a highly customizable and feature-rich live chat solution designed for real-time customer engagement. Its extensive configuration options and powerful features make it suitable for businesses of all sizes, looking to provide exceptional customer support.

Key Features:
- Multilingual Support: Offer chat support in multiple languages, catering to a diverse customer base.
- Canned Responses: Speed up response times with pre-set replies, ensuring consistent and quick answers to common queries.
- Visitor Tracking: Monitor visitor activity on your website in real-time, allowing for proactive engagement and better support.
- Chat Routing: Route chats to the right department or agent, ensuring customers receive specialized assistance quickly.
- Reporting: Generate detailed reports on chat performance and agent activity, providing insights for continuous improvement.
Fun Fact:
Live Helper Chat is known for its extensive customization options, allowing businesses to tailor almost every aspect of the chat experience.
5. Rocket.Chat
Rocket.Chat is an open-source team communication platform that includes live chat functionality, making it a versatile tool for both internal and external communication. Its comprehensive feature set and robust integrations make it a powerful solution for enhancing customer support and team collaboration.

Key Features:
- Omni-Channel Communication: Integrate live chat, email, and social media messages in one platform, streamlining customer interactions.
- Customizable Widgets: Design chat widgets to fit your brand’s style, ensuring a seamless user experience.
- Mobile and Desktop Apps: Provide support from anywhere with mobile and desktop apps, enhancing accessibility for both agents and customers.
- End-to-End Encryption: Ensure secure communication with end-to-end encryption, protecting sensitive customer information.
- API and Integrations: Integrate with a wide range of tools and platforms using the open API, enabling custom workflows and extended functionality.
Fun Fact:
Rocket.Chat was originally created as an internal communication tool for a Brazilian company but quickly evolved into a popular open-source project with millions of users worldwide.
6. Helpy
Helpy is a customer support platform that combines ticketing, knowledge base, and community forums with live chat functionality. This all-in-one solution allows businesses to manage all aspects of customer support from a single interface, enhancing efficiency and customer satisfaction.

Key Features:
- Multi-Channel Support: Manage customer interactions across live chat, email, and community forums, providing comprehensive support.
- Knowledge Base Integration: Provide instant answers with integrated knowledge base articles, reducing the need for agent intervention.
- Customizable Interface: Tailor the interface to match your branding, ensuring a consistent customer experience.
- AI-Powered Suggestions: Use AI to suggest relevant knowledge base articles during chats, improving response times and accuracy.
- Analytics and Reporting: Monitor performance with detailed analytics and reporting tools, helping you identify areas for improvement.
Fun Fact:
Helpy started as a simple ticketing system but has evolved into a comprehensive customer support platform, thanks to contributions from its active open-source community.
7. Tiledesk
Tiledesk is an open-source live chat and messaging platform that integrates with chatbots to automate customer support. This hybrid approach allows businesses to combine automated and human interactions, enhancing efficiency and customer satisfaction.

Key Features:
- Chatbot Integration: Automate responses and handle common queries with chatbots, reducing the workload for human agents.
- Multi-Channel Support: Manage conversations from live chat, email, and messaging apps in one platform, providing a unified support experience.
- Customizable Widgets: Adjust chat widgets to fit your website’s design, ensuring a seamless user experience.
- Real-Time Monitoring: Track visitor activity and engage proactively, enhancing customer engagement and support effectiveness.
- Open API: Extend and integrate with other tools using the open API, enabling custom solutions and workflows.
Fun Fact:
Tiledesk combines live chat with chatbot capabilities, providing a hybrid solution that enhances both automated and human interactions.
8. Chaskiq
Chaskiq is an open-source live chat and customer engagement platform designed to help businesses communicate effectively with their customers. Its robust feature set and user-friendly interface make it an excellent choice for businesses looking to enhance their customer support efforts.

Key Features:
- Omni-Channel Messaging: Manage live chat, email, and social media interactions in one platform, streamlining customer support.
- Customizable Chat Widgets: Design chat widgets to align with your brand, creating a cohesive customer experience.
- Automated Workflows: Streamline tasks with automation and workflows, improving efficiency and response times.
- Analytics and Insights: Gain insights into customer interactions with analytics tools, helping you improve service quality.
- Multi-Language Support: Provide support in multiple languages, catering to a global audience.
Fun Fact:
Chaskiq was developed by a small team of passionate developers who wanted to create a powerful, open-source alternative to proprietary customer engagement tools.
9. FreeScout
FreeScout is a lightweight and powerful open-source help desk and live chat software that’s easy to install and customize. Its simplicity and effectiveness make it a popular choice for businesses looking to implement a robust support system without the complexity of larger platforms.

Key Features:
- Ticketing System: Manage customer inquiries with an integrated ticketing system, ensuring all queries are tracked and resolved.
- Customizable Chat Widgets: Personalize chat widgets to match your website’s branding, enhancing the user experience.
- Automated Responses: Use canned responses to handle common queries efficiently, reducing agent workload.
- Email Piping: Convert emails into support tickets automatically, ensuring no customer inquiry is missed.
- Multi-Language Support: Offer support in various languages to cater to a diverse audience, improving customer satisfaction.
Fun Fact:
FreeScout is often considered a perfect self-hosted alternative to Zendesk, offering similar features without the high costs.
FAQ Section
1. What is open-source live chat software?
Open-source live chat software is a type of customer support tool whose source code is publicly available. This allows businesses to use, modify, and distribute the software according to their needs.
2. Why should businesses choose open-source live chat software?
Businesses should choose open-source live chat software for its cost-effectiveness, flexibility, security, community support, and transparency. These benefits make it an ideal choice for businesses looking to provide excellent customer support without incurring high costs.
3. Can open-source live chat software be customized?
Yes, one of the primary advantages of open-source live chat software is its high degree of customization. Businesses can modify the software to meet their specific needs and integrate it with other tools and systems.
4. Is open-source live chat software secure?
Open-source software can be very secure because its code is open for inspection. This transparency allows developers and users to identify and fix vulnerabilities quickly. However, the actual security depends on how well the software is maintained and updated.
5. How can open-source live chat software improve customer support?
Open-source live chat software can improve customer support by enabling real-time communication, reducing response times, providing multi-channel support, and offering insights through analytics and reporting. These features help businesses address customer issues more efficiently and effectively.
6. Are there any costs associated with using open-source live chat software?
While the software itself is typically free, there may be costs associated with hosting, customization, and maintenance. However, these costs are generally lower than those of proprietary software solutions.
7. Can open-source live chat software integrate with other tools?
Yes, most open-source live chat software comes with APIs and integration options, allowing businesses to connect the chat system with other tools such as CRM software, email platforms, and analytics tools. This integration capability helps streamline workflows and enhance overall efficiency.